University of Arkansas-Fort Smith students gear up for Cub Camp

Date: Category:US Views:2 Comment:0


FORT SMITH, Ark. (KNWA/KFTA) — First-year students will get their first experience with college life at the University of Arkansas-Fort Smith’s annual Cub Camp on August 14.

365 new students will be on campus for the university’s three-day student orientation program.

The camp runs through August 16 and is supported by 120 student volunteers who serve as counselors, chairs, and directors.

The program combines educational sessions with social activities to help students foster community, leadership skills and newfound independence.

Around 200 students will get their first opportunity to live on campus in their new dorms.

Highlights of this year’s camp include the team-based Cub Camp Games, Family Feud and the traditional showcase dance off.
